Rey Urbano, who painted his face and called himself the Great Kabooki in the early 1970s, passed away yesterday at a nursing home in Las Vegas. Urbano was not a major star with the gimmick, that he used into the early 80s when he retired from the ring. At about the same time Urbano's career was winding down, Gary Hart took the gimmick and accelerated it, adding nunchakus, a wig, the green mist and martial arts for Akihisa Mera, who became an international star as the Great Kabuki. this is from dave meltzers wrestling observer column for 10/18/07
